How they compare
SDG: Western Asia currently reports 21.3% against 10.7% in Guinea, a difference of 10.6%.
That makes SDG: Western Asia's figure about 2.0 times Guinea's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 5 shared years of data; in 2013 it was SDG: Western Asia ahead.
Guinea ranks 154th and SDG: Western Asia ranks 153rd of 163 countries.
SDG: Western Asia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
